Installing the app on the parent's Android device
Tutorina is a powerful app designed to help you guide and support your child in developing a balanced digital lifestyle. Follow these simple steps to install and configure the Tutorina app on your Android device.
Step 1: Download and Install Tutorina from the Google Play Store
- Open the Google Play Store on your Android device.
- Search for "Tutorina" in the search bar.
- Select the Tutorina app and press "Install."
Step 2: Choose the user
- Open the application and select Parent's Device.
Step 3: Provide contact information
- Enter your phone number.
- Select the days you want to be contacted.
- Choose your preferred time to be contacted.
Step 4: Create an Account or Log In
- Open the Tutorina app after installation.
- Select "Parent's Device."
- Choose one of the account creation options:
- Continue with Apple
- Continue with Google
- Register with email and password
Step 5: Add a child
- Enter your child's name.
- Select the month and year of birth.
- Choose the child's gender.
- Upload a profile photo or select an avatar.
Step 6: Create an Agreement
- Set the daily screen time allocated to your child.
- Add daily activities that the child must complete to earn extra time (e.g., homework, reading, chores).
Step 7: Connect the child's device
- Press "Connect the child's device."
- Enter the code that appears on your child's device.
- Follow the instructions on the screen to complete the connection.
Step 8: Configure the parental PIN code
- Create a 4-digit PIN code that you will use to access the app's settings.
- Confirm the PIN code by entering it a second time.
Step 9: Manage notifications
- Choose whether you want to allow the Tutorina app to send you notifications. It is important to allow notifications for the app to function properly.
